Climate: Precipitation and temperature averages over 30 years of recording

Weather: Everyday atmospheric conditions, changes all the time

Climate versus Weather

Precipitation per year over at least 30 yearsRecorded temperature variations and

averages over 30 yearsDetermines what kind of vegetation growsVegetation determines what animals live

thereMany different climatic regionsTropical (Wet, Dry), Sub-tropical, temperate

marine, temperate continental, tundra, polar.

Climate

Changes everydayCurrent atmospheric conditions of a

particular placeTemperaturePrecipitationWarm and cold fronts change weatherCommon storms: Thunderstorms, blizzards,

tornadoes, hurricanes, winter storms, etc.

Weather

Receives over 100 inches of rainfall a yearYear round growing season300 species of trees in one acre of land¼ of medicine comes from plants found hereAmazon River has more species of fish than

the entire Atlantic OceanRains everydayAverage temperature is 78 degrees

Fahrenheit

Tropical Wet or Moist Climate

Very dry areaPrecipitation is mostly in form of snowfall10 inches of snow= 1 inch of rainVery cold year roundGrowing season is less than 3 monthsShrubs and grasses are the only vegetationMany migratory animals that search for food

Tundra Climate
